What Is Child Abuse?
Child abuse can involve neglect or physical, sexual, or emotional harm against a child. Perpetrators of child abuse can include parents, family members, caregivers, strangers, teachers, or other children. Child abuse can happen during an isolated event or repeated abuse over time. Child abuse is a serious crime, and people deemed “mandatory reporters” (doctors, educators, police, etc.) must report suspected child abuse.

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Family Law Attorney To Help With Child Abuse?
Careless claims of child abuse can cause emotional, financial, and family harm. Parents in a bad divorce may falsely claim abuse to get custody or punish the other parent. A family law attorney can protect you and your relationship with your child. Without an attorney, allegations of child abuse could mean losing custody and suffering permanent harm to your reputation.

What Are the Top Questions When Choosing a Family Law Lawyer?
These questions can help you decide if you feel comfortable and confident that a lawyer has the qualifications, experience, and ability to manage your case well. Many family law lawyers offer free consultations that allow you to understand your options and get specific legal advice before hiring them. The top questions include:
- What is your experience in family law?
- Are you familiar with Chicago and Illinois courts and judges?
- Have you managed cases like mine before?
- How do you manage potential conflicts of interest?
- What are the potential outcomes of my case?
- What is your fees and billing structure?
- How involved will I be in strategy decisions about the case?
